Earthscapes is a visually stunning nature documentary series that explores the wonders of the natural world across various ecosystems and topographies. Filmed in high definition, each episode of this series is a feast for the eyes and takes audiences on a breathtaking journey through stunning landscapes, from the vast steppes of Mongolia to the dense rainforests of South America.
Hosted by Jeff Corwin, a conservationist and wildlife biologist, Earthscapes offers a unique perspective on the beauty and complexity of our planet. Corwin's passion for the environment is evident in his narration, which is informative yet engaging, and never feels preachy or didactic.
One of the things that sets Earthscapes apart from other nature documentaries is its focus on specific regions of the world. Each episode is dedicated to exploring a particular ecosystem, from the grandeur of the Canadian Rockies to the frozen tundra of the Arctic. By zeroing in on these distinct environments, the series is able to showcase the unique flora and fauna that call them home, from the majestic grizzly bear to the elusive snow leopard.
The series also devotes a considerable amount of time to the people who live in and rely on these environments. Through interviews with local experts, we learn about the challenges and opportunities that come with living in these regions, as well as the efforts being made to preserve them for future generations.
As much as Earthscapes is about the beauty of nature, it is also about the importance of conservation. Each episode highlights the impact that human activity has on these ecosystems, whether it's the destruction of animal habitats due to logging, or the pollution of water sources caused by industrial activity. This emphasis on conservation serves as a reminder that we all have a responsibility to protect the natural world.
In terms of production values, Earthscapes is nothing short of remarkable. The series was filmed using cutting-edge technology, including drones and high-speed cameras, which allows for stunning footage of animals in motion and landscapes that seem to stretch on forever. The filmmakers have a keen eye for detail, capturing the smallest of creatures in exquisite detail, and the series is expertly edited to create a sense of drama and tension, especially during scenes of animal predation.
